Mann IslandHere’s one for your diary – especially if you’ve seen our Total Eclipse of the Heart piece. Matt Brook, the man responsible for the Mann Island development (on behalf of Neptune Developments and Countryside Properties) will be talking about his “optimistic, people-orientated approach and passion for design” in a free talk on the 23rd June.

Matt Brook, will ‘present an insight into the design and construction of the Mann Island development’.

Yeah, we’d love an insight.  Bet you would, too.

12-12.45pm. 23 June. Free. Maritime Museum, Liverpool.
